This opportunity is for the complete roof replacement at the West Somerville Neighborhood School in Somerville, MA. - Government Buyer: - City of Somerville, MA - Procurement & Contracting Services Department - Managed by IAM Capital Projects; Stantec Architecture and Engineering PC is the designer - Project Scope: - Full removal of existing deteriorated roofing materials - Installation of a new energy-efficient roofing system - Includes related HVAC, plumbing, and ornamental iron roof accessories - Products/Services Requested: - Roofing system replacement (no specific OEMs or part numbers specified) - HVAC and plumbing work associated with the roof - Miscellaneous and ornamental iron roof accessories - Quantities: - One complete roof replacement project (entire school roof) - Notable Requirements: - Estimated construction cost: $2,700,000 - Bidders may need DCAMM certification in General Building Construction, roofing, HVAC, and plumbing - 100% performance and payment bonds required - 5% bid bond required with submission - Compliance with Massachusetts prevailing wage laws, OSHA training, and city ordinances (wage theft, responsible employer) - Liquidated damages of $1,000 per day for delays - Multiple forms and certifications required as detailed in the bid package - No specific OEMs or proprietary products are named; bidders may propose suitable commercial roofing systems

Description

This solicitation is for the removal of deteriorated roofing materials and installation of a new energy-efficient roofing system at the West Somerville Neighborhood School located at 177 Powder House Boulevard, Somerville, MA. The project may require DCAMM certification in General Building Construction, roofing, HVAC, and plumbing trades, along with 100% performance and payment bonds. The estimated construction cost is $2,700,000. The contract commencement is anticipated on August 10, 2026, with completion by March 31, 2027. Bidders must submit a complete bid package including various required forms and a 5% bid deposit.
